Greater Memphis AreaFounder @ CleanEndo CleanEndo's patent pending technology is designed to enhance the pre-cleaning process of flexible endoscopes and MIS devices. In conjunction with advanced cleaning our single use device provides damage protection to the distal tip, which accounts for more then 75% of total scope damage experienced by healthcare facilities. CleanEndo was created in response to the overwhelming market demand for better flexible endoscope cleaning processes. Our approach is to prevent organic matter from drying on the distal tip and internal channels by providing the ability to pre-soak with mechanical fluid agitation at point of use and during transport to decontamination.
